Description: PseudoTV is a free open source software add-on for the Kodi media center. It allows users to set up customized 'TV channels' on their Kodi system that play content from their local media libraries.

PseudoTV
PseudoTV Features
  • Create customized TV channels from local media library
  • Supports live TV integration
  • Channel surfing interface
  • EPG guide with current and upcoming programs
  • Support for plugins to pull data from online sources
  • Automated channel creation based on media categories
  • Customizable channel logos and backgrounds
